What Is a Drop Ceiling?

A drop ceiling is a secondary ceiling installed below the structural ceiling using a suspended metal grid system. Ceiling panels or tiles are placed into the grid, creating a finished ceiling while leaving an accessible space above for electrical wiring, HVAC ductwork, plumbing, fire sprinkler systems, network cabling, and other building utilities. This design allows technicians to easily access building systems without cutting into drywall, making future maintenance faster and less expensive.

Why Commercial Buildings Choose Suspended Ceilings

Drop ceilings have become the standard in many commercial environments because they combine aesthetics with functionality.

Easy Access to Building Systems

One of the biggest advantages is the ability to remove individual ceiling tiles whenever maintenance is required. Electricians, plumbers, HVAC technicians, and IT professionals can quickly access wiring and equipment without damaging finished surfaces.

Improved Acoustics

Many commercial ceiling tiles are designed to absorb sound, helping reduce echo and background noise. This creates a quieter environment for offices, conference rooms, medical facilities, schools, and retail businesses where clear communication is important.

Energy Efficiency

A suspended ceiling reduces the volume of space that must be heated or cooled, often helping HVAC systems operate more efficiently while improving occupant comfort.

Professional Appearance

Modern ceiling tiles are available in numerous textures, sizes, and finishes that create a bright, clean, and welcoming environment for employees and customers alike.

Simplified Repairs

If a ceiling tile becomes stained from a roof leak or damaged during maintenance, it can usually be replaced individually instead of repairing and repainting an entire drywall ceiling.

Choosing the Right Ceiling Tiles

Not all ceiling systems are the same. Selecting the right tile depends on how the space is used.

Acoustic Ceiling Tiles

Ideal for offices, classrooms, and conference rooms where reducing noise is important.

Moisture-Resistant Tiles

Commonly installed in kitchens, restrooms, healthcare facilities, and humid environments.

Washable Ceiling Panels

Perfect for medical offices, laboratories, food service areas, and clean environments where sanitation is essential.

Decorative Ceiling Systems

Available in modern patterns and finishes to complement upscale office interiors, retail stores, and customer-facing spaces.

Why Professional Installation Matters

Commercial ceiling installation requires careful planning and precision. Proper installation ensures:

  • Straight, level grid systems
  • Secure suspension from the building structure
  • Proper integration with HVAC, lighting, fire sprinklers, and electrical systems
  • Compliance with applicable commercial building codes
  • A clean, finished appearance

An improperly installed ceiling can sag, shift, or create alignment issues that become increasingly noticeable over time.
